Justice Stevens actually made note of the fact that currect medical marijuana laws trouble him. He said something to the effect of, I hope this debate can find its way to the halls of Congress (not an exact quote; I can't seem to find it). But since that was not the issue before the court, he had no choice but to make a finding "against" users of medical marijuana.
Originally Posted by nicholasstanko
It really was the right thing to do. Whether you agree with it or not, marijuana has been a so-called controlled substance since the '40s and the Court rightly found that the federal government has jurisdiction over such things.
If the laws were changed, obviously, the Supreme Court would've responded differently. That needs to be the focus.bhallg2k Reviewed by bhallg2k on .
